We are supporting a large, well-established organisation in the search for a
People Analytics Team Manager
. This is a key leadership role for someone who can bring strong people management skills, confident stakeholder engagement, and the ability to shift HR reporting from data-heavy outputs towards meaningful insights that shape decision making.

The role

You will lead a team of seven (including two incoming apprentices), ensuring they are in the right roles, supported, and delivering high-quality work. The team already provides a range of HR reporting — from absence, turnover and sickness data, through to monthly scorecards, service KPIs and dashboards for the HR Directors and Executive Committee.

The focus now is on stepping beyond data manipulation into meaningful analysis. Stakeholders, particularly at HRD level, are looking for insights they can act on, and you will be central in setting expectations, pushing back when needed, and ensuring the team's outputs are valued at the highest level.

While you won't be hands-on with reporting on a daily basis, you'll be expected to support your team with guidance, challenge, and coaching, alongside managing stakeholder conversations. The technical set-up is still evolving (currently manual processes, moving towards Azure with Power BI), so resilience and pragmatism will be important.
